What I Check First Before Buying
The first thing I look at is the size of the pillar light and whether it matches the post or column where I plan to install it. I also check the brightness level, battery capacity, and solar charging efficiency. If the light is too small, it can look out of place; if it is too dim, it won’t give me the effect I want.
Brightness and Light Output
I always pay attention to lumens because that tells me how bright the light will be. For decorative lighting, I may not need very high brightness, but for pathways or security, I want stronger output. I also prefer lights with warm white tones when I want a cozy look, while cool white works better when I want a cleaner and brighter appearance.
Battery Life and Solar Charging
In my experience, battery performance is one of the most important factors. I look for lights that can last through the night after a full day of charging. I also check whether the solar panel is large enough to collect sunlight efficiently, especially if the installation area does not get direct sun all day. A good battery and efficient panel make a big difference in reliability.
Material and Weather Resistance
Since these lights stay outdoors, I make sure the materials are durable and weather-resistant. I prefer aluminum, stainless steel, or high-quality ABS plastic because they tend to handle rain, heat, and cold better. I also look for waterproof ratings so I know the lights can survive outdoor conditions without failing too soon.
Design and Style
I choose a design that matches my home’s exterior. Some extra large solar pillar lights have a classic lantern look, while others have a modern or minimalist style. I like selecting a finish that blends with my fence, deck, or patio so the lights look intentional rather than added as an afterthought.
Installation and Fit
I always measure the pillar or post before buying. Extra large lights need the right base size to sit securely. I prefer models that are easy to install without complicated wiring because that saves me time and effort. A stable fit also helps prevent damage from wind or accidental movement.
Lighting Modes and Features
Some lights offer multiple modes, such as steady glow, flicker, or color-changing effects. I find these features useful when I want flexibility for different occasions. I also like automatic dusk-to-dawn sensors because they turn the lights on and off without me having to do anything.
Maintenance and Long-Term Use
I try to choose lights that are easy to maintain. A solar panel that I can clean quickly is important because dirt and dust can reduce charging efficiency. I also check whether the bulbs or batteries can be replaced, since that can extend the life of the light and save me money over time.
